I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Maven Java Discussion :

[Maven1.0.2][Debutant] Maven et Subversion


Sujet :

Maven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Avril 2004
    Messages
    48
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Avril 2004
    Messages : 48
    Par défaut [Maven1.0.2][Debutant] Maven et Subversion
    Bonjour,

    Je débute avec Maven et j'essai tant bien que mal a effectuer un checkout sur notre subversion.

    Je m'explique, nous avons une repository Subversion sur un serveur. J'y accède sans problème avec le plugin Eclipse et TortoiseSVN. Je voudrais executer un script maven afin d'effectuer un checkout de la même manière...
    J'ai trouvé le plugin maven-scm-plugin que j'ai téléchargé et installé par la commande :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    plugin:download -DgroupId=maven -DartifactId=maven-scm-plugin -Dversion=1.6
    Ensuite, j'ai tenté de l'utilisé par la commande :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    scm:checkout
    -Dmaven.scm.url=scm:svn:https://srcSVN/ -Dmaven.scm.checkout.dir=C:/vide/checkout/MY_PROJECT/
    Mais j'obtiens le message d'erreur suivant :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    [INFO] Command line: svn --non-interactive checkout https://srcSVN MY_PROJECT
    Command line: svn --non-interactive checkout https://srcSVN MY_PROJECT
    Provider message:
    The svn command failed.
    Command output:
    'svn' n'est pas reconnu en tant que commande interne
    ou externe, un programme ex‚cutable ou un fichier de commandes.
    J'aurais oublié une étape ? Quelqu'un aurait il la solution ?

    Merci

  2. #2
    Membre Expert

    Profil pro
    Inscrit en
    Mai 2006
    Messages
    1 172
    Détails du profil
    Informations personnelles :
    Âge : 50
    Localisation : France, Yvelines (Île de France)

    Informations forums :
    Inscription : Mai 2006
    Messages : 1 172
    Par défaut
    Citation Envoyé par Gauden
    Bonjour,
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    scm:checkout
    -Dmaven.scm.url=scm:svn:https://srcSVN/ -Dmaven.scm.checkout.dir=C:/vide/checkout/MY_PROJECT/
    Mais j'obtiens le message d'erreur suivant :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    [INFO] Command line: svn --non-interactive checkout https://srcSVN MY_PROJECT
    Command line: svn --non-interactive checkout https://srcSVN MY_PROJECT
    Provider message:
    The svn command failed.
    Command output:
    'svn' n'est pas reconnu en tant que commande interne
    ou externe, un programme ex‚cutable ou un fichier de commandes.
    J'aurais oublié une étape ? Quelqu'un aurait il la solution ?

    Merci
    Tu dois avoir svn dans ton PATH

  3. #3
    Expert confirmé

    Avatar de denisC
    Profil pro
    Développeur Java
    Inscrit en
    Février 2005
    Messages
    4 050
    Détails du profil
    Informations personnelles :
    Âge : 45
    Localisation : Canada

    Informations professionnelles :
    Activité : Développeur Java
    Secteur : Service public

    Informations forums :
    Inscription : Février 2005
    Messages : 4 050
    Par défaut
    Citation Envoyé par Gauden
    Bonjour,

    Je débute avec Maven et j'essai tant bien que mal a effectuer un checkout sur notre subversion.
    Euh, je n'ai pas de solution à ton problème, mais simplement une remarque: Si tu es débutant avec Maven (comme c'est marqué dans ton titre), je te conseille vivement d'utiliser Maven 2 (.0.4) qui est la nouvelle version de Maven, bien plus puissante et simple d'utilisation (à mon sens) que la version précédente....

    Sur ton problème, maven a besoin (apparement), d'un client svn en ligne de commande. Un tel client est disponible avec TortoiseSVN, mais il n'est probablement pas dans ton path (enfin je suppose).

  4. #4
    Membre averti
    Profil pro
    Inscrit en
    Avril 2004
    Messages
    48
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Avril 2004
    Messages : 48
    Par défaut
    Déjà, merci d'avoir répondu si rapidement.
    Pour répondre à DenisC, je n'ai malheureusement pas le choix, nous utilisons cette version dans notre projet.

    Je me doutais qu'on allait me répondre que c'était un problème de path... Mais en fait, j'ai bien ajouté TortoiseSVN à ma variable PATH windows et ça ne marche toujours pas.
    J'ai alors installé un Subversion sur mon poste afin d'avoir un executable svn.exe, je l'ai ajouté à ma variable et là non plus, ça ne marche pas

    C'est comme si maven n'avait pas le même PATH...
    Je suis sûr d'être prêt du but mais là je bloque. En plus, je ne trouve rien sur le google à ce propos

  5. #5
    Membre averti
    Profil pro
    Inscrit en
    Avril 2004
    Messages
    48
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Avril 2004
    Messages : 48
    Par défaut
    Bon ok j'ai un peu honte là... Vous pouvez vous moquer
    En fait, je n'avais tout simplement pas relancé Eclipse

    Merci quand même

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Debutant Maven Hibernate
    Par henpower dans le forum Maven
    Réponses: 1
    Dernier message: 24/03/2009, 21h59
  2. Distribution Eclipse Maven Tomcat Subversion
    Par Bouiaw dans le forum Eclipse
    Réponses: 0
    Dernier message: 08/11/2008, 19h55
  3. [MAVEN1] Cruise Control et Maven &
    Par DanielW33 dans le forum Maven
    Réponses: 2
    Dernier message: 14/05/2007, 16h21
  4. [debutant] release:prepare et subversion
    Par gigigao dans le forum Maven
    Réponses: 8
    Dernier message: 27/10/2006, 15h36
  5. [Maven][Debutant]Specifier jar a utiliser
    Par royto dans le forum Maven
    Réponses: 1
    Dernier message: 06/07/2005, 10h46

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o